Top locations to stay in Marquelia

Some great areas to stay in when visiting Marquelia, Guerrero, Mexico, are Playa Ventura, Juchitán, and Copala. Playa Ventura offers beautiful beaches and relaxation, while Juchitán boasts cultural landmarks like the Santuario Del Senor Del Perdon and Catedral Santiago Apostol. Copala enchants with its charming colonial architecture. For first-time visitors, Playa Ventura is the most appealing choice.

Best time to go to Marquelia

Marquelia experiences its lowest average temperature in January, at 79.5°F (26.4°C), while May is the hottest month, with an average temperature of 84.4°F (29.1°C). September is usually the wettest month. March, April, and December are the peak travel months in Marquelia, attracting a higher number of tourists. During this peak period, the weather is sunny, with no rainfall. On the other hand, August to October tend to be quieter times to visit, marked by moderate to frequent rainfall and mostly sunny to mostly cloudy conditions.
